Slip compensation gain at high speed (18-01)
(1) It is not required to adjust the Slip compensation gain at high speed if the motor is loaded.
(2) After adjusting parameter 18-00 it is recommended to increase the reference frequency and
check the motor speed. In case of a speed error increase the value of 18-01 to adjust the
compensation.
(3) Increase the motor rated frequency (01-12 base frequency) and increase the value of 18-01 to
reduce the speed error.
(4) Compared to 18-00, 18-01 serves as a variable gain for the full speed range.
(5) If the speed accuracy becomes worse due to an increase in motor temperature it is
recommended to use a combination of 18-00 and 18-01 for adjustment.
